The Vegetarian Keto Diet is a low-carb, high-fat diet that emphasizes non-animal sources of protein and healthy fats. This type of diet has become increasingly popular among people who want to follow a ketogenic lifestyle but also maintain a vegetarian or vegan diet.
The key principle of the ketogenic diet is to reduce carbohydrate intake and increase the consumption of healthy fats in order to induce a metabolic state called ketosis. During ketosis, the body uses fat as its primary source of energy instead of glucose from carbohydrates. This leads to weight loss and improved health markers such as reduced inflammation and improved blood sugar control.
The standard ketogenic diet involves the consumption of large amounts of animal products such as meat, eggs, and dairy. However, for those who follow a vegetarian or vegan diet, these foods are not options. Fortunately, there are many delicious and nutritious vegetarian-friendly foods that can be included in a ketogenic diet.
Protein Sources:
The primary source of protein in a vegetarian ketogenic diet should come from non-animal sources such as nuts, seeds, and legumes. Some examples include almonds, chia seeds, flax seeds, pumpkin seeds, sesame seeds, sunflower seeds, and hazelnuts. These foods are high in healthy unsaturated fats and contain a good amount of protein. In addition, legumes such as lentils, chickpeas, and black beans are also good sources of vegetarian protein. Tofu and tempeh are also popular choices for vegetarians on a ketogenic diet as they are low in carbohydrates and high in protein.
Healthy Fats:
Healthy fats are an essential component of a vegetarian ketogenic diet. Good sources of healthy fats include avocados, olive oil, coconut oil, coconut cream, and coconut milk. Nuts and seeds, as mentioned earlier, are also good sources of healthy fats.
Vegetables:
Vegetables should make up a large portion of a vegetarian ketogenic diet. Leafy greens such as spinach, kale, and lettuce are low in carbohydrates and high in fiber. In addition, non-starchy vegetables such as broccoli, cauliflower, and zucchini can be consumed in large amounts. These vegetables are low in carbohydrates and high in fiber, making them perfect for the ketogenic diet.
Dairy Alternatives:
For those who follow a vegan diet, dairy products are not an option. Fortunately, there are many dairy alternatives available that are suitable for a ketogenic diet. Coconut milk, almond milk, and soy milk are popular choices as they are low in carbohydrates and high in healthy fats.
